What defines the Silent Generation?

The “silent generation” are those born from 1925 to 1945 – so called because they were raised during a period of war and economic depression. The “baby boomers” came next from 1945 to 1964, the result of an increase in births following the end of World War II.

What is the silent Greatest Generation?

Generally speaking, the Greatest Generation are the parents of the “Baby Boomers” and are the children of the “Lost Generation” (those who grew up during or came of age during World War I). They preceded what is known as the “Silent Generation,” a cohort born between the mid-1920s to the early-to-mid 1940s.

What is the Silent Generation?

What motivates the Silent Generation?

Many in the Silent Generation grew up with a lack of security, witnessing a financial collapse and war. In general, they seek financial security and stability. They see work as a privilege and are grateful for job security. They understand their worth and will seek opportunities to provide for their families.

What is your age if you are a part of the Silent Generation?

The Silent Generation is a generational cohort currently consisting of seniors in their mid-70s, 80s, and early 90s. They are situated between the Greatest Generation (the generation that served during World War II) and the Baby Boomers.
